Monthly Monitoring Reports <br /> The Discharger shall submit to the Regional Board and Department of Toxic Substances Control <br /> monthly operation reports by the 15`h day of the following month. These operational reports shall <br /> contain a summary of the results of monitoring, including effluent and injection well flow rates, <br /> volume of treated water, pressure readings, and water levels, operation and maintenance activities <br /> for that month, and a summary of any shutdown and/or spill events that occur that month. Quarterly Monitoring Reports <br /> Quarterly reports shall be submitted to the Regional Board on the 1st day of the second month <br /> following the end of each calendar quarter(i.e., by 1 February, l May, 1 August, and 1 <br /> November). At a minimum, the reports shall include: <br /> 1. A description and discussion of the sampling event and results, including trends in the <br /> concentrations of pollutants,how and when samples were collected, and whether the pollutant <br /> plume(s) is being captured; <br /> 2. A summary of operation and maintenance tasks performed, including inspections, problems <br /> encountered repairs, maintenance, and equipment replacement performed (as applicable); <br /> 3. The reasons for and duration of all interruptions in the operation of the remediation system, and <br /> actions planned or taken to correct and prevent interruptions, if applicable; <br /> 4. Results of influent, effluent, and observation well monitoring. Data shall be presented in tabular T <br /> format in such a manner as to clearly illustrate trends in concentrations for each well over time; 11-1 <br /> 5. A comparison of monitoring data to the effluent limits and discharge specifications and an <br /> explanation of any violation of those requirements; <br /> 6. Copies of all laboratory analytical report(s)that includes laboratory quality assurance/quality <br /> control sampling data; <br /> 7. A calibration log verifying weekly calibration of any field monitoring instruments (e.g., DO,pH, <br /> EC meters) used to obtain data; and <br /> 8. Any proposed change in the extraction well network with justification for the change. <br /> C. Annual Report <br /> An annual report shall be submitted to the Regional Board by 1 February of each year. This report <br /> shall contain an evaluation of the effectiveness and progress of the remediation, and may be <br /> submitted with the fourth quarter monitoring report.
